Study on the microstructure of thin-layer facade plasters of thermal insulating system during artificial weathering

Investigations involving the influence of simulate weathering on the microstructure of thin-layer plasters laid on foamed polystyrene are reported. In order to examine internal changes, two kinds of properties were examined in time per 100 cycles during 400 cycles. One of the properties is an open porosity connected with pore structure tested by the mercury intrusion method (MIP), and total porosity examined by helium intrusion technique (HIP). The other property is mineral composition analyzed on X-ray diffraction (XRD) and scanning electron microscopy (SEM). The results have shown that changes of porosity, pore structure and chemical microstructure of plasters occured after successive weathering. In tested plasters, greater changes were noticed above the gaps of thermal insulation boards than beyond them. Porosimetry tests resulted in greater variations of open porosity over the gaps. Similarly, higher amounts of calcium carbonate were found in plasters and background mortars in places over the gaps of polystyrene boards.
